Summary

Despite growing evidence of geothermal activity under Yellowstone, it look geologists a long time to realize there was a volcano beneath this wildlife preserve, and an even longer time to find the crater. Ariel photographs revealed this is 45 miles wide, encompassing the whole of Yellowstone! What will happen, in human terms, when it erupts? Greg Breining explores the shocking answers to this question and others in this scientific and accessible look at this enormous disaster brewing beneath one of the world's best-known parks. Historically, Yellowstone has erupted every 600,000 years, but has not done so for 630,000 years, meaning it is 30,000 years overdue - any day now, in geological terms! Yellowstone is one of the worlds five "SuperVolcanoes", and when it erupts the entire world will be affected dramatically and for years! Starting with a scenario of what will happen when Yellowstone blows, this fascinating study describes how volcanoes function and a timeline of famous volcanic eruptions throughout history.

Author Biography

Greg Breining has written several books on the natural world, including Wild Shore, an account of two seasons kayaking around Lake Superior; Minnesota, a travel book in the Compass American Guide series; and Return of the Eagle, the illustrated story of how America saved its national symbol. He also writes essays and articles for The New York Times, National Geographic Traveler, National Geographic Adventure, Sports Illustrated, Audubon, Islands, Wildlife Conservation, Minnesota Monthly, and others. He lives in St. Paul, Minnesota, with his wife, Susan Binkley.
